mysql怎么选中多行
时间 : 2023-08-01 09:05: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

在MySQL中,要选中多行数据,可以使用SELECT语句加上WHERE子句进行条件过滤。下面是一些常见的选中多行数据的方法:

1. 使用IN关键字:可以使用IN关键字来选择满足多个条件的行。例如,选中ID为1、2、3的行可以使用以下语句:

SELECT * FROM table_name WHERE id IN (1, 2, 3);

2. 使用BETWEEN关键字:可以使用BETWEEN关键字来选择满足范围条件的行。例如,选中ID在1到10之间的行可以使用以下语句:

SELECT * FROM table_name WHERE id BETWEEN 1 AND 10;

3. 使用通配符LIKE:可以使用通配符LIKE来选择满足特定模式的行。例如,选中名字以"J"开头的行可以使用以下语句:

SELECT * FROM table_name WHERE name LIKE 'J%';

4. 使用逻辑运算符:可以使用逻辑运算符来组合多个条件进行筛选。例如,选中ID大于3且名字以"A"开头的行可以使用以下语句:

SELECT * FROM table_name WHERE id > 3 AND name LIKE 'A%';

以上是一些常见的选中多行数据的方法,根据具体的需求可以选择适合的方法来实现。